.vc -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, but no presence requirements.
It can be used as a re-purposed TLD to stand for "Venture Capital", "Virtual Community", "Vancouver" (my city!) or something along those lines.
One of the most interesting things about this TLD is that you can still register two character domains while most exts don't allow that anymore.

For example, I own http://DN.vc/ and it's a domain industry news site.

.bz - Belize, but also no presence requirements and has been marketed to stand for "Business." I've already seen some requests to add a .bz forum, so count me in as an extra vote...

How about .TH ? Maybe just a flag on top?

Thailand's THNIC runs the registry for this ccTLD. They used to run the only registrar, but the last couple of years have seen considerable liberalization. There are several competing registrars now, and I expect ownership restrictions to be removed in the coming years as well.

.co.th is stillextremely restrictive and according to the information we got, it doesn't look like they will change in the near future. A couple of years back they decided to release .th toplevel, but shortly after the information leaked, the plan was canceled.

There are still many good domains available in the .co.th domain space, but the same can be said for .co.id for example.

@snicksnack the .co.th domains are restricted to those with companies registered in Thailand. Individuals need to get .in.th
For me the most promising area is the IDN *.th, which are allowed as second level domains like ***3650;***3619;***3591;***3649;***3619;***3617;.th

I see some of the EU countries' attraction to their local country codes as a way of seeking out local companies, as opposed to global corps found by typing in *.com I think this trend is here to stay as citizens get more net savvy, and I think it'll be true in Thailand as well.

I also like the Thai language with .th instead of ASCII, since their words are so difficult to transliterate without ambiguity. The only way advertisers can pass the "radio test" is to use native language domains.
